Customers are paying a lot for electricity these days. Some are thinking how great it would be to take advantage of solar energy floating free from the sky. But would solar even work for their home? And what would it cost to install -- how long before they’d see any savings? For 170 families in the city of Baltimore, there’s good news in a program called “Baltimore Shines,” organized by the non-profit Civic Works. People with low and moderate incomes can have solar installed and connected free.

If you loved one of the 1,549 people who died in Maryland of an overdose in the past twelve months -- if you’re a brother, a parent, a daughter, a friend -- it may be small comfort that that number is 30 percent lower than the year before and has been trending downward since 2021. It’s still too high. Emily Keller, Maryland’s ‘Special Secretary of Overdose Response, is charged with leading Maryland’s fight against overdose deaths.

The violence and uprising after Freddie Gray died in police custody ten years ago shook Baltimore to its core. We ask executive director Todd Marcus and Rikiesha Metzger, interim director of the Jubilee Arts program at Intersection of Change, a community center in Gray’s Sandtown-Winchester neighborhood, what’s changed, and what hasn’t.
